General Info

This Combined midle school and high school event has been held at Brooke High School since 2014. This year we are switching venues across the street to Brooke Middle School. We like to host this event early and encourage teams to bring what they have so far. Pushing yourself to meet this early date and coming regardless of the status of your build really helps get your team starrted and understanding the game. There will also be a drone tournament on Sunday the 10 th

Code of Conduct

The REC Foundation considers the positive, respectful, and ethical conduct of teams to be an essential component of the competition. Participants are expected to behave in a respectful and professional manner, and to operate as student-centered teams with limited adult assistance. This includes all students, teachers, coaches, mentors, parents, and spectators associated with a team.

For more details, please refer to the REC Foundation Code of Conduct and Student-Centered Policy. If you have concerns about compliance with the Code of Conduct, please speak to the Event Partner during the event.
